MongoDB Python Driver (PyMongo)

Skjermbilde programvare:
MongoDB Python Driver (PyMongo)
Prog.varedetaljer:
Versjon: 3.0.1 Oppdatert
Last opp dato: 12 May 15
Lisens: Gratis
Popularitet: 180

Rating: nan/5 (Total Votes: 0)

MongoDB database er et dokument-orientert NoSQL database, perfekt for høy intensiv belastning miljøer.
Den MongoDB Python Driver lar utviklere å skrive programmer som kobler, lagre og hente informasjon fra en MongoDB database.
Dette er en MongoDB kontakten opprettet og støttet av den offisielle MongoDB utviklingsteamet, som kommer fullpakket med massevis av eksempler og dokumentasjon.
MongoDB kommer også med drivere for diverse andre programmeringsspråk i tillegg:
C
C #
C ++
PHP
Perl
Java
Rubin
Scala
Erlang
Node.js
Haskell

Hva er nytt i denne versjonen:

  • En enhetlig klient klasse. MongoClient er den eneste klienten klasse for tilkobling til en frittstående mongod, replikasett, eller sharded klyngen. Migrering fra en frittstående, til et replikasett, til en sharded klynge kan oppnås med kun en enkel URI endring.
  • MongoClient er mye mer mottakelig for konfigurasjonsendringer i ditt MongoDB distribusjon. Alle tilkoblede servere er overvåket på en ikke-blokkerende måte. Treg til å reagere eller ned serverne ikke lenger blokkere server oppdagelse, redusere programmet startes og tid til å svare på nye eller rekonfigureres servere og replica sett failover.
  • En enhetlig CRUD API. Alle offisielle MongoDB drivere nå implementere en standard CRUD API slik at Polyglot utviklere å flytte fra språk til språk med letthet.
  • Enkelt kilde støtte for Python 2.x og 3.x. PyMongo avhengig ikke lenger på 2to3 å støtte Python tre.
  • En omskrevet ren Python BSON gjennomføring, bedre ytelse med PYPY og cpython distribusjoner uten støtte for C-utvidelser.
  • Bedre støtte for greenlet basert async rammer inkludert eventlet.
  • Uforanderlige klient, database og innsamlings klasser, unngå en rekke tråd sikkerhetsspørsmål i klientprogrammer.

Hva er nytt i versjon 3.0:

  • En enhetlig klient klasse. MongoClient er den eneste klienten klasse for tilkobling til en frittstående mongod, replikasett, eller sharded klyngen. Migrering fra en frittstående, til et replikasett, til en sharded klynge kan oppnås med kun en enkel URI endring.
  • MongoClient er mye mer mottakelig for konfigurasjonsendringer i ditt MongoDB distribusjon. Alle tilkoblede servere er overvåket på en ikke-blokkerende måte. Treg til å reagere eller ned serverne ikke lenger blokkere server oppdagelse, redusere programmet startes og tid til å svare på nye eller rekonfigureres servere og replica sett failover.
  • En enhetlig CRUD API. Alle offisielle MongoDB drivere nå implementere en standard CRUD API slik at Polyglot utviklere å flytte fra språk til språk med letthet.
  • Enkelt kilde støtte for Python 2.x og 3.x. PyMongo avhengig ikke lenger på 2to3 å støtte Python tre.
  • En omskrevet ren Python BSON gjennomføring, bedre ytelse med PYPY og cpython distribusjoner uten støtte for C-utvidelser.
  • Bedre støtte for greenlet basert async rammer inkludert eventlet.
  • Uforanderlige klient, database og innsamlings klasser, unngå en rekke tråd sikkerhetsspørsmål i klientprogrammer.

Hva er nytt i versjon 2.8.

  • Full støtte for MongoDB 2.6

Hva er nytt i versjon 2.6.3:

  • Versjon 2.6.3 fikser problemene rapportert siden utgivelsen av 2.6.2, viktigst en semafor lekkasje når en tilkobling til serveren mislykkes.

Hva er nytt i versjon 2.6:

  • Versjon 2.6 inneholder noen ofte bedt om forbedringer og legger til støtte for noen tidlig MongoDB 2.6 funksjoner.

Hva er nytt i versjon 2.5.1:

  • Denne utgivelsen løser noen race conditions i replica satt overvåking .

Hva er nytt i versjon 2.4.1:

  • Denne versjonen fikser en regresjon ved hjelp av: meth: ` ~ pymongo.collection.Collection.aggregate`.

Hva er nytt i versjon 2.4:

  • : Klasse: `~ pymongo.mongo_client.MongoClient` ( Og: Klasse:. `~ pymongo.connection.Connection`) støtter nå Unix domene sockets
  • : Klasse: `~ pymongo.cursor.Cursor` kan kopieres med funksjoner fra: mod.:` Copy` modul
  • : meth.: `~ Pymongo.database.Database.set_profiling_level` metoden støtter nå en slow_ms alternativ

Hva er nytt i versjon 2.3:

  • Støtte for utvidet lesepreferanser inkludert regi leser til tagget servere - Se: ref.: `sekundær-reads` for mer informasjon
  • Støtte for Mongos failover - Se: ref.: `Mongos-high-availability` for mer informasjon
  • En ny: meth.: `~ Pymongo.collection.Collection.aggregate` metode for å støtte MongoDB nye aggregering rammeverk
  • Støtte for eldre Java og C # byte rekkefølge når koding og dekoding UUID.

Hva er nytt i versjon 2.2.1:

  • Denne versjonen fikser en inkompatibilitet med mod_wsgi 2.x som kan føre tilkoblinger å lekke.

Hva er nytt i versjon 2.2:

  • Støtte for Python 3
  • Støtte for Gevent
  • Forbedret tilkoblingsgrupper

Hva er nytt i versjon 2.1.1:

  • Versjon 2.1.1 er en mindre utgivelse som fikser noen problemer oppdaget etter utgivelsen av 2.1.

Hva er nytt i versjon 2.1:

  • Versjon 2.1 legger til noen hyppig etterspurte funksjonene og inkluderer vanlig runde med feilrettinger og forbedringer.

Lignende programvare

Apache Tajo
Apache Tajo

10 Feb 16

BigDump
BigDump

12 May 15

Annen programvare fra utvikleren MongoDB Development Team

Kommentarer til MongoDB Python Driver (PyMongo)

Kommentarer ikke funnet
Legg til kommentar
Slå på bilder!